About this resource
This quiz focuses on Veterans Day and related military history concepts, targeting elementary students in grades 3-5. The questions assess students' understanding of American civic holidays, military history, and the distinction between commemorative occasions. Students need foundational knowledge about U.S. military branches, the historical origins of Veterans Day in World War I's Armistice Day, and the difference between honoring living veterans versus fallen soldiers. The quiz also requires basic inferential reasoning skills, particularly in analyzing the connection between military service and leadership development. The content builds essential civic literacy by helping students understand how our nation honors military service and the historical context behind national holidays. Created by Scott Bartlett, a History teacher in the United States who teaches grades 3-5. This assessment serves as an excellent tool for introducing or reinforcing lessons about American holidays and military history during November classroom activities. Teachers can use this quiz as a pre-assessment to gauge student knowledge before Veterans Day lessons, as a formative assessment during a social studies unit, or as a review activity following related instruction. The questions work well for both individual practice and small group discussions, particularly when exploring the historical progression from Armistice Day to modern Veterans Day observances. This quiz aligns with NCSS standards for civic ideals and practices, as well as time, continuity, and change, while supporting elementary social studies curricula that emphasize understanding national symbols, holidays, and the role of military service in American society.
